Output 22660fb2183edc9a3ab19c438fb280e34be50addce3f556a3ac67652548be639:4

value
93842080
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e05295060a60c0e7263789fcfa1334facb598e8 OP_EQUAL
address
MF1h81f2AWkwGN1m6UQH8DBBcssC1wkrXx
transaction
22660fb2183edc9a3ab19c438fb280e34be50addce3f556a3ac67652548be639
spent
true